Why Pools Lose Water in Roosevelt, NJ
Slow pool water loss may result from multiple factors common to the Roosevelt area and surrounding counties:
- Underground Broken Pipes: Aging or damaged plumbing lines beneath the pool can cause constant water loss. Garden soil in Monmouth County is known for shifting due to freeze/thaw cycles, increasing the risk of pipe ruptures.
- Skimmer Leaks and Return Fittings: Skimmers and returns are high-traffic areas for leaks. Damaged gaskets or cracks can cause slow drainage.
- Vinyl Liner Tears: For vinyl liner pools, punctures or seam separations—often hidden under steps or fittings—are common culprits.
- Environmental Factors: Roosevelt’s soil composition and seasonal temperature swings can cause cracks in concrete or gunite pools, leading to leaks.
Understanding these issues highlights why it’s essential to seek expert leak detection. Guessing and random digging often cause more harm than good.
Expert Leak Detection Techniques in Roosevelt, NJ
At Pool Patcher®, we use advanced technology specific to roosevelt nj pool leak detection services to ensure accurate diagnosis before repairs.
- Electronic Leak Detection: Our technicians use electronic amplifiers and listening devices to pinpoint water escape points, even in vinyl liners or fiberglass pools.
- Pool Pressure Testing: This critical test isolates underground plumbing lines by pressurizing them individually, helping locate breaks without unnecessary excavation.
- Pipe Leak Locating: If pressure testing confirms a break, we deploy precise electronic locating equipment to minimize digging and provide repair guidance.
- Pool Pipe Camera Inspections: Using video cameras inside pipes, we check for cracks, blockages, or breaks, offering visual proof and clearer repair plans.

Leak Identification vs. Evaporation: Why Proper Testing Matters
Many pool owners confuse natural evaporation with leaks. Here’s why professional testing matters:
- Leak vs Evaporation: Evaporation rates vary but typically do not cause significant daily water loss. Professional water loss verification identifies whether water drops exceed normal evaporation.
- Liner vs Plumbing Leak: Visual inspections may not spot plumbing leaks hidden underground. Our methods isolate leaks to a specific area before recommending repair or liner patching.

Frequently Asked Questions About Roosevelt NJ Pool Leak Detection Services
Q1: How much water loss is normal in a residential pool?
Typically, pools lose about 1/4 inch of water daily due to evaporation, depending on local weather.
Q2: How much does professional pool leak detection cost in NJ?
Costs vary based on pool type and testing needed. Pressure testing is often charged separately unless bundled with a full inspection.
Q3: How long does pool leak detection take?
Most inspections, including electronic leak detection and pressure testing, are completed within a few hours.
Q4: Do I need to drain my pool for leak detection?
No, our methods detect leaks without draining, preventing damage to your pool and saving time.
Q5: Can leaks cause damage beyond water loss?
Yes. Undetected leaks can damage pool structure, promote soil erosion, and increase repair costs.
